Client side validation not working

Jason ByrnesWebAssist

the validation you have here is the restrict content validation set to restrict the following characters:
$ % and ,


this will nor set the field to only allow numbers, it will still allow letters using this validation type.

Also, since this validation type is applied to the on blur event of the text field, it will not prevent the form from submitting if the validation does not pass.

I dont recommend using client side validation for this, the downside to using client side validation is that it can be easily foiled by disabling javascript ion your browser.

I would recommend using Server Side validation instead, and using the numeric validation type, not restrict content.
